A LARGE BRONZE COUPLE DEPICTING SIVA AND PARVATI SOUTH INDIA, CIRCA 1900 Each standing erect on a lotus base on raised square plinth, the four armed god with primary hands in abhaya and varada mudra, his upper hands holding elephant goad and a deer, his consort holding a lotus, each with tall headdress and billowing robes, on an associated bronze shrine base, probably Western Deccan, with scrolling openwork back plate and lobed arch.36cm without base, 40cm with base, and 34.5cm without base, 38cm with base, each 11cm x 11cm at base, and bases 14.5cm x 14.5cmProvenance: Private collection, England, thence by descent
